- >Would anyone possibly know where I might find an 8 inch floppy controller
- >for the ISA bus, 8 or 16 bit. I just need to get software off of some old
- >8 inch disk I still have.

- If all you want to do is get software off of one 8-inch disk, and that's it,
- why not look in the back of either PC magazine or the Computer Shopper. I've
- seen many ads in their classified section for media conversion. Maybe you
- could get one of these companies to do it for you. They may charge a bit much,
- but it will probably cost you less, in time and effort as well as money, than
- if you went out and bought a controller card and a drive (assuming you don't
- have them already.
